    Fans of The Sims could be in for a treat as the first game is slated for a digital release for the first time, as well as a re-release of Sims 2 to celebrate the series' 25th anniversaryTech13:21, 28 Jan 2025Updated 13:21, 28 Jan 2025The Sims 1 is iconic(Image: Electronic Arts)The Sims 4 might be free-to-play, but if you yearn for a simpler time, you might be in luck as EA is reportedly gearing up for a huge celebration for the series' 25th anniversary.The long-running life sim that lets players create a virtual family and manage their day, work life and relationships has long captivated its audience, but Kotaku is reporting that the first two Sims games are set to be re-released this week.That's particularly important for the first Sims game which never saw a digital release, and is therefore tricky to get hold of and play.Content cannot be displayed without consentKotaku's report claims both games will be re-released on PC "before the end of the month", but no further information is available on console ports.That ties in nicely with the post on X (formerly Twitter) above which suggests 'Time Travel' before using the same colour scheme from the series' earliest entries.Developer Maxis Games has been teasing a return to older Sims titles, using classic sound effects in a presentation in recent weeks, and Kotaku has suggested the games will come with all of their original expansion packs included.The Sims 2 could be returning, with all of its expansions(Image: Electronic Arts)The first game, which launched in 2000, was only released physically, while Sims 2's online features were taken offline in 2013, too.The current version, Sims 4, launched in 2014, and is still supported with regular updates and 'Stuff' packs. Sims 5 is currently dubbed Project Rene, and is in development but likely won't launch for some time.Article continues belowAnecdotally, my wife will be so happy if the rumours are true, having played the first game for hundreds of hours when she was younger, and I'm sure there are thousands of players in a similar boat.Looking to play something else?     Trevor was the breakout star of GTA 5 (Rockstar)Actor Steve Ogg has a fittingly brutal idea for how GTA 6 could bring back his character from GTA 5.Although the upcoming GTA 6 will star a new pair of protagonists, in the form of Bonnie and Clyde-esque duo Lucia and Jason, many GTA 5 fans hope that some of the original cast will make an appearance.Back in 2023, it was speculated that one of GTA 5s leads, Michael, could return, based on a seemingly innocuous comment by his actor, Ned Luke. But nothing has ever been explicitly confirmed.The actor behind GTA 5s most popular lead, Trevor, hasnt previously commented on his involvement but while he doesnt seem to be part of GTA 6, thats not because of a lack of interest.Is GTA 5s Trevor coming back in GTA 6?In a recent interview with Screen Rant, Steven Ogg, who provided the voice and motion capture for Trevor in GTA 5 and GTA Online, said he has not done any voice recording for GTA 6.While this seems to rule out Trevor making a speaking appearance, Ogg added hed still love to be brought back for the sequel if only so he can be killed off right at the beginning.I think that would be cool, because it also acknowledges the fans of like, Hey, thank you. Pass the torch, stomp Trevors head in, and sort of put an end to that and allow a new generation to take over, explained Ogg. Trevor was apparently going to get his own DLC expansion but it was cancelled (Rockstar)Its honestly not a bad idea for a cameo, especially since it directly parallels Trevors own introduction in GTA 5, where he brutally kills Johnny Klebitz, the protagonist of GTA 4s The Lost And The Damned DLC.Rockstar has kept very tight-lipped about GTA 6s story and cast, beyond what was shown in the reveal trailer. Although fans believe they know whos been cast as Lucia.More TrendingIts entirely possible GTA 6 will see some characters from previous games make an appearance. At the very least, fans will get to revisit an old location in Vice City, the titular setting of 2002s GTA: Vice City.That game was set in the 80s, though, whereas GTA 6 will feature a more contemporary rendition of the city; one that includes several areas directly inspired by real-world locations in Florida.As for Ogg, while GTA 5 was more than 10 years ago, hes kept busy with other acting roles in both film and television, including recurring roles in The Walking Dead and Westworld.In 2016, he also reprised his role as Trevor in a fan-made live-action short film called GTA VR, which depicted a holodeck style rendition of GTA, rather than an actual VR version.     WWE 2K25 preview The Bloodline rules, Island and redefining wrestling gamesAlistair McGeorgePublished January 28, 2025 1:00pm Roman Reigns takes centre stage in WWE 2K25 (Picture: 2K)WWE 2K25 has officially been unveiled with Roman Reigns on the cover and The Bloodline taking centre stage.Publisher 2K and developer Visual Concepts have promised something special this year, as they continue to revitalise the franchise and repair goodwill after relaunching with WWE 2K22 following the disappointment of WWE 2K20.Last years instalment hit all the right notes, and this year the team are aiming to improve things further with Intergender Wrestling, the Underground match, the return of chain wrestling, The Bloodlines Dynasty Showcase, The Island mode, and more.Roman and his familys dynasty are at the heart of this years edition and his Wiseman Paul Heyman thinks thats the right call.What a historic moment for this to happen, right in the middle of what is unquestionably the hottest run, the hottest box office run in the history of professional wrestling/sports entertainment/WWE, he exclusively told Metro.For me personally, for the first time to have a corner man, Wiseman, special counsel I hate the term manager, but Ill use it here on the cover is an extraordinary breakthrough that, with all false humility aside, I feel the tribal chief and his wise man richly deserve. All three covers have been unveiled for the new game (Picture: 2K) Paul Heyman is proud to be part of the game (Picture: WWE/Craig Melvin)The Bloodline is the headline for this years game, with even Showcase shifting to make sense of the saga.Gone is the Slingshot technology, with full cut scenes now back and players in control of the matches, which are split into three forms: the standard Showcase match reliving big moments; the chance to change history by giving a classic bout a new result; and dream matches, with legends from The Bloodline family against modern day superstars.Theres also the addition of Bloodline Rules, which Derek Donahue, Visual Concepts lead combat designer on the WWE 2K series, has revealed is a new Payback ability all about run-ins and drama.Obviously, weve had run-ins in the game before, but in a much more limited way, he told us, noting under Bloodline Rules the new Payback can be used three times by each superstar, turning a singles match into a four versus four brawl. The Bloodline saga is a huge part of this years game (Picture: 2K)To view this video please enable JavaScript, and consider upgrading to a webbrowser thatsupports HTML5videoUp NextIts kind of like WarGames, but without the restriction of necessarily being in the cage area. Its almost like a gauntlet match. Its kind of a hybrid of all sorts of things with this Bloodline theming built in, he added.Another new addition this time round is The Island, described by 2K as an interactive world made up of a series of areas built around differentWWEthemes, which sees players trying to impress Roman Reigns and earn a contract.The online mode is exclusive to P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X/S, rather than last gen consoles, and will let you take on challenges and live events to earn unlockables through different storylines.Andrea Listenberger, a writer for the series, with experience on the WWE creative team, has kept her cards close to her chest regarding the feature but promised more information in the future. The Island is a brand new mode coming to WWE 2K25 (Picture: 2K)What I will say about The Island is if MyRise is bringing video games to wrestling, The Island story is more like bringing wrestling to video games. Speaking of MyRise, this year the career mode which follows a user-created rookie rising through the ranks of WWE will focus on a singular, multi-gender storyline seeing the likes of Bayley, Kevin Owens, and more infiltrating NXT in an attempt to take control of the entire company.This also sees the introduction of the NXT Parking Lot as a brawl environment (the WWE Archives has also been confirmed), while the mode will come with plenty of storyline branches, unlockables and the like.What about the game itself? 2K and VC have introduced more than just Bloodline Rules this year, with Intergender Wrestling coming to the franchise. Intergender Wrestling will be part of this years game but wont be forced on players (Picture: 2K)Players are being given complete freedom, with male and female superstars able to compete against each other in all match times, while the Underground match has newly redefined combat.The team note that the idea that the ring doesnt have ropes has changed everything when it comes to AI and the way matches can work, with Underground even having spectators around the ring banging on the mat.In terms of the matches in general, Chain Wrestling is back with developers promising more control for players, while the addition of Barricade Dives including walking along the barrier to deliver high spots is a welcome one.The team has also boasted its biggest ever roster of WWE superstars and legends, while they didnt rule out the possibility of newcomers like Penta making it into the game. Fans are hoping its not too late for Penta to part of the game (Picture: WWE)We want people to get surprised and excited. Just wait. Every year, we got something cool for you all, Lynell teased, while a question about TNA Wrestling being incorporated in the five DLC packs was met with a similarly vague response.While the Universe sandbox mode (the return of promos) and MyGM (online play) are also being improved, MyFaction remains a key part of the game, despite fans criticising the use of microtransactions.Although unlockables are possible through hard work, players have complained about how hard it can be to work through, with plenty of people suggesting the so-called Persona Cards (which can be use in all game modes) could be provided as a one-off DLC pack later in the games lifecycle.     By Margherita Bassi Published January 28, 2025 | Comments (0) | The mask mould discovered in Sicily. Finziade Project / Parco Archeologico e Paesaggistico della Valle dei Templi A familiar face has resurfaced from the ruins of an ancient Greek city in Italy. Archaeologists in Sicily have discovered what they believe to be an ancient Roman mask mould depicting the iconic Medusa. Under the direction of Roberto Sciarratta from the Valley of the Temples Archaeological Park, they unearthed the mould in a building from the late Republican period (133 to 31 BCE) in the ruins of Finziade, as detailed in a January 23 statement by the Sicilian regional government. The finding sheds light on the intersectionality of spiritual and cultural life in ancient Rome. Its not hard to see why the archaeologists immediately thought of the snake-headed womanthe mould depicts a stern face surrounded by what appears to be wild, thick-stranded hair. What you see in the photo is a matrix, used in ancient times as a negative impression for making artifacts. By applying material to the cast, it was molded, taking on the shape of the matrix! reads a Facebook post by the Finziade Project, the research program encompassing the excavations and co-directed by Alessio Toscano Raffa for the Institute of Heritage Science in Catania, a region of Sicily. A matrix is a kind of mould. Parco Archeologico e Paesaggistico della Valle dei Templi According to Greek mythology, Medusa had snakes instead of hair and a (literally) petrifying gaze. Though the ancient sources sometimes disagree on her back story, she was one of three sibling monsters called Gorgons, according to Hesiods Theogony. Unfortunately, shes perhaps best known for her death at the hands of Perseus.The Greek hero beheaded Medusa and afterwards continued to use the severed head to turn his enemies to stone. As a result, scholars suggest that Medusas frequent depictions throughout antiquityfrom mosaics to columns to coinswere made to be protective charms. Designated House 18, the building where the archaeologists discovered the 2,000-year-old mould had most likely been converted into a workshop for the production of masks around the beginning of the first century BCE. Archaeologists had previously discovered similar artifacts in comparable contexts, so the recent finding further confirms the importance of mask production to this area.Finziade, also spelled Phintias, was an ancient Greek colony and city founded in 282 BCE by Finzia (or Phintias), the tyrant ruling over the city of Akragas. Rome conquered it just two decades after its founding, and today its located near the modern-day city of Licata in southwestern Sicily. The masks produced from the mould itself may have been used in decorative, ritual, or theatrical contexts, as reported by The History Blog. As a consequence, the artifact highlights the significant overlap between spirituality and culture in ancient Rome. It also sheds light on the artisanal productions and symbolic culture of ancient Finziade.     Those logging onto their email this morning may have a surprise in store, whether elation or crushing disappointment. Nintendo is sending out its first invites for its Switch 2 Experience for hands-on time, with the upcoming console set to start in April. Nintendo declared it would share more about the sequel Switch that month, but this will be the first time regular folks can handle Nintendos next handheld console. Those who get a Switch 2 Experience confirmation email will see the Congratulations! at the top of their page, followed by a date and time for their session. Nintendo planned events in New York, Los Angeles, and Dallas, Texas in the U.S., plus multiple other events around the globe from April through June. The first event will occur April 4 through April 6 in Manhattan, New York. If youre like me, youll log on to your email as excited as a kid on Christmas, only to find Nintendo has dashed your hopes with a Sorry, but you and/or your party were not selected in this drawing. The email then offers a link to Nintendos registration page, where you can hop on a waitlist. The waitlist should be on a first-come, first-served basis in case anybody who received a ticket cancels within the next three months. It will become available starting Jan. 29 at 4 p.m. ET, 1 p.m. PT. Maybe this is a message from Nintendo that its better to abandon hope before your dreams can be dashed once more.Nintendos January Switch 2 reveal didnt offer much insight into the upcoming console beyond screen size, ergonomics changes, and the new magnetically attached JoyCons. We still have to rely on the rumor mill for system specs, rumored upscaling capabilities, and possible launch title lineup. In the meantime, third-party peripheral makers have already set preorders for cases, driving wheels, and other accessories. Arecently revealed patent from Europe hinted that Nintendo could be offering some more Wii-like motion-sensing capabilities for the Switch 2, but that doesnt necessarily mean the tech will pertain to Nintendos upcoming console. As for when we may finally get our hands on the console, it may come after Nintendos planned Direct online press conference slated for April.Some fansgot excited over a Finnish online retailers supposed May 9 release date. Still, we have our doubts about its veracity, considering its stated 999 euro price tag and the use of screenshots ripped straight from Nintendos reveal video.If anything, these rumors prove that the wait for more Switch 2 details will be as excruciating as the long road to the initial announcement.

    Social Media-Friendly Design: Is Architecture Adapting to Viral Trends and Algorithms?Save this picture!Prompt: An image that embodies the essence of social media: a giant screen displaying photographs of architectural and interior projects, with a person at the center, standing with their back turned, absorbing the scene. Image Courtesy of Enrique Tovar using DaVinci AII saw it on Instagram! It's a phrase we often hear in various contexts, from the latest restaurant recommendations to the trendiest hotel in town. The window to observe and expose ourselves to the outside world now sits in our smartphones. This doesn't necessarily mean it's all doom and gloom. Still, it reflects that we're constantly flooded with data and information segmented by algorithms, all in a super easy-to-consume format. In today's world, it takes only a few seconds to form a lasting impression of a building and its atmosphereand those first impressions matter more than we often realize.So, here's the thing: Is our perception of architecture shifting to fit this new dynamic, with an increasing focus on creating designs that are likely to go viral? Sure, there's a lot of mystery surrounding the omnipresent algorithm. Still, it's worth exploring this conversation, which raises intriguing questions about architecture's futureone where emerging architects are so deeply embedded in social media that their influence becomes nearly impossible to ignore.Save this picture!It is true that in the past, everything moved at a much slower pace. Keeping up with the world of architecture, seeking inspiration, discovering new processes or materials, required hours of searching through magazines, conversations with colleagues, and travels. Rather than saying that times were better in the old days when architecture classics defined the landscape, the reality is that information flowed more slowly. With improvements in transportation infrastructure, technology, and the advent of the Internet, the world became more connected, and everything accelerated. Social media fit into that momentum, transforming a familiar dynamic into one faster and more accessible than ever before. However, as with many innovations, this acceleration introduces new concepts, advantages, and interesting setbacks. The rise of Instagrammable and Viral Architecture: What Defines It? In a world of immediate connection, the concepts of "Instagrammable" and "social media-friendly design" emerged, referring to architecture designed for digital audiencesnot only to be experienced but also to be shared on social media. These spaces prioritize almost entirely visual impact, photogenic, and the ability to provoke instant reactions and engagement on platforms like Instagram and TikTok. This phenomenon highlights how digital platforms shape architectural trends and influence how we conceptualize and are engaged with spaces. Architecture is evolving with digital trendsnot because its core purpose has changed, but because the medium requires a different approach to communication and influences design choices. Today, the image we project is as important as its function, with the purpose following the post.This process's "successful" outcome is virality, when something spreads quickly and extensively, reaching a much larger audience than anticipated. While there is no established formula for achieving virality, factors known to encourage it include relevance, originality, alignment with trends, and ease of consumption. However, this is where it gets tricky: by focusing excessively on virality and imitating the outcomes of projects that achieved it, we risk introducing biases into design decisions and material selection.Save this picture! Material Selection in Architecture: Risks of Trend-Driven Homogenization Discussing materials becomes a natural next step when a project concentrates on aesthetics. After all, no design can take shape without the materiality that defines it. However, an important dilemma arises: How many options are available? The short answer is "countless", but the issue is more complex. In a world defined by global interconnection, the possibility of obtaining products from the other side of the planet has become normalized, allowing practically everyone access to the same resources. This reach has led us to enjoy unprecedented diversitybringing with it significant sustainability costswhich, in theory, expands creative possibilities.Today, a material not only fulfills a compositional function but also brings a certain uniqueness, reaching a relevance comparable to trendy products. From sneakers to gadgets, certain objects are symbols of the contemporary. This phenomenon has a parallel in design, where colors, shapes, textures, and specific furniture elements are consolidated as means of adopting the aesthetic of viral architecture. However, by focusing on a limited set of options, is global access to materials driving the homogenization of design? Abandoning approaches that focus on the real needs of projects could inevitably lead to short-term results.Save this picture!Has virality already become a necessity? The challenge is not merely selecting the right material for its technical properties, but leveraging the nearly infinite possibilities at our disposal to create something that transcends the next trend. Possible futures of architecture in the social media age involve balancing innovation with timeless design, ensuring that new trends do not overshadow the long-term integrity of the built environment.Design trends driven by virality are shaped by the generational influences behind the stimuli we encounter on social media. These platforms reflect diverse conceptions of the world, molded by the characteristics and values of each generation. Analyzing the trends that emerge in our feeds, two main spectrums can be distinguished: on the one hand, millennials, and on the other, Gen Z, which has surpassed the former in number for some years now.Save this picture!Save this picture!Generation Z generally gravitates toward colorful elements, organic shapes, and eye-catching texturesqualities distinctly reflected in product design and fashion. In the built environment, particularly in interiors, this phenomenon translates into a renewed interest in maximalism, where the message is clear: "Less is a Bore" contrasting with the minimalism that defined previous generations.Although minimalist aesthetics catering to millennial preferences persist, many spaces have started to incorporate more subtle color elements, often in pastel tones. This "late minimalism" appears to be an attempt to adapt to emerging trends, even with an unconscious resistance to the bolder and more vibrant aesthetics favored by younger generations. It will be interesting to observe how both spectrums evolve, shaped by generational transitions and the trends they bring. However, contrary to popular belief in design, neither is here to stay. Only time will reveal their evolution, paving the way for the upcoming Generation Beta and the possibilities they will bring.Save this picture!We are in a transition where the metaverse, AI-driven architecture, and data insights are shaping future designs. In a world where online platforms constantly provide data on user preferences, architects could adopt a more metrics-based approach to building design. This means taking into account not only user demographics, but also social media activity: what types of spaces are most frequently shared, how people interact with those environments, and what visual elements resonate with digital audiences. Public opinion and digital audiences could become a driving factor in the design of buildings or spaces. Will architects be able to design timeless structures that balance social media trends and functionality?In the opposite sense, there's a chance that all this will settle down just as other technologies and innovations did when they reached their peak. Or why not? Counter-narratives will emerge that spark a new era of innovation, taking the focus away from the influences of social media and turning the gaze back to regional architectural styles, local resources, and manual processes. Perhaps what was perfected over centuries will regain prominence over what was designed to capture our attention for only a few seconds.
